Daniel Nova Acquires 40,000 Shares of Harley-Davidson (NYSE:HOG) Stock

Harley-Davidson, Inc. (NYSE:HOGGet Free Report) Director Daniel Nova acquired 40,000 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Friday, July 31st. The shares were acquired at an average cost of $24.57 per share, for a total transaction of $982,800.00. Following the completion of the acquisition, the director owned 47,605 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$1,169,654.85. This trade represents a 525.97% increase in their ownership of the stock. Harley-Davidson (NYSE:HOGG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, July 23rd. The company reported $0.75 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.65 by $0.10. The business had revenue of $1.23 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.17 billion. Harley-Davidson had a return on equity of 6.28% and a net margin of 4.78%.The business’s revenue was down 5.9%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the business posted $0.88 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Harley-Davidson, Inc. will post 0.5 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Harley-Davidson Announces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, June 25th. Shareholders of record on Monday, June 8th were issued a $0.1875 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Monday, June 8th. This represents a $0.75 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.8%. Harley-Davidson’s payout ratio is currently 46.01%.

About Harley-Davidson

Harley-Davidson, Inc is a renowned American motorcycle manufacturer best known for its heavyweight cruiser and touring bikes. Founded in 1903 in Milwaukee, Wisconsin, the company has built a strong reputation for producing distinctive motorcycles characterized by their signature V-twin engines, chrome finishes and robust frames. Harley-Davidson markets its products globally through a network of franchised dealerships and focuses on delivering an immersive brand experience to its customers, emphasizing lifestyle and community alongside its motorcycles.

In addition to its core motorcycle business, Harley-Davidson offers an extensive range of parts, accessories and apparel under its Genuine Motor Parts & Accessories and MotorClothes lines.
